Common Issues with the Clock Spring Triton and Solutions

The clock spring Triton is an integral component of the vehicle’s steering column. It is responsible for maintaining the electrical connection between the steering wheel and the various controls, such as the horn, cruise control, and audio system. However, like any mechanical part, the clock spring can experience issues over time.

One common issue with the clock spring in the Triton is a loss of electrical connection. This can result in a range of problems, such as a non-functioning horn or audio controls. In some cases, the clock spring may even cause the airbag warning light to illuminate, indicating a potential safety issue.

Fortunately, there are solutions available for addressing clock spring issues in the Mitsubishi Triton. In most cases, the clock spring will need to be replaced to resolve the problem. This can be done by a qualified technician, who will carefully remove the steering wheel and replace the faulty clock spring with a new one.

Tips for Maintaining Your Mitsubishi Triton Coolant Tank

Taking care of your Mitsubishi Triton coolant tank is essential for maintaining the overall health and performance of your vehicle’s cooling system. Here are some tips to help you keep your coolant tank in optimal condition:

  1. Regularly check the coolant level: It is important to check the coolant level in your Triton coolant tank regularly. Ensure that the coolant level is within the recommended range indicated on the tank. If it is low, top it up with the appropriate coolant mixture.
  2. Inspect for leaks: Periodically inspect your coolant tank for any signs of leaks. Look for puddles of coolant under your vehicle or any visible cracks or damage to the tank. If you notice any leaks, have them repaired as soon as possible to prevent further damage.
  3. Clean the tank: Over time, debris and sediment can accumulate in the coolant tank, affecting its performance. To prevent this, clean the tank periodically by draining the coolant and rinsing the tank with clean water. Make sure to remove any built-up residue before refilling with fresh coolant.
  4. Replace the coolant: Coolant deteriorates over time, losing its effectiveness in preventing overheating and corrosion. It is recommended to replace the coolant in your Triton at regular intervals, as specified in the owner’s manual. Replacing Your Mitsubishi Pajero Starter Motor: A Step-by-step Guide

Replacing your Mitsubishi Pajero starter motor may seem like a daunting task, but with the right guidance, you can do it yourself! Follow this step-by-step guide to replace your starter motor and get your Pajero up and running smoothly.

  1. Gather the necessary tools: Before you begin, make sure you have all the tools you’ll need for the job. This typically includes a socket set, wrenches, pliers, and a jack and jack stands to safely lift and support your vehicle.
  2. Disconnect the battery: Start by disconnecting the negative terminal of your vehicle’s battery to prevent any electrical accidents while working on the starter motor.
  3. Locate the starter motor: The starter motor is typically located near the bottom of the engine, on the transmission housing. It is cylindrical in shape and has electrical connections and mounting bolts.
  4. Remove the electrical connections: Carefully disconnect the electrical connections to the starter motor. This usually includes the main power cable and a smaller solenoid wire. Take note of how these wires are connected, as you’ll need to reconnect them correctly later.
  5. Remove the mounting bolts: Using the appropriate tools, loosen and remove the mounting bolts that secure the starter motor to the transmission housing. Keep these bolts in a safe place, as you’ll need them for the installation of the new starter motor.
  6. Install the new starter motor: Position the new starter motor in place, aligning it with the mounting holes on the transmission housing. Insert and tighten the mounting bolts securely.
  7. Reconnect the electrical connections: Reattach the electrical connections to the new starter motor, making sure to connect them in the same way as they were on the old starter motor. Double-check that everything is securely connected.
  8. Reconnect the battery: Once the starter motor is securely installed and all electrical connections are made, reconnect the negative terminal of your vehicle’s battery.
  9. Test the new starter motor: Start your Pajero to ensure that the new starter motor is functioning properly. If the engine starts smoothly without any issues, then congratulations – you’ve successfully replaced your Mitsubishi starter motor!

Remember, if you’re unsure about any step or don’t feel comfortable performing the replacement yourself, it’s always best to consult a professional mechanic. They have the knowledge and expertise to ensure a safe and accurate replacement of your starter motor.

FAQS

Q: What is the purpose of the Mitsubishi Overflow Bottle?

A: The overflow bottle plays a crucial role in maintaining the proper functioning of the Triton’s cooling system. It collects excess coolant and expands when the engine heats up, ensuring that the coolant levels remain consistent and preventing overheating.

Q: How often should I check the coolant level in the overflow bottle?

A: It is recommended to check the coolant level regularly, especially before long trips or during hot weather. It’s a good practice to visually inspect the overflow bottle every month or so, and top up the coolant if needed.

Q: Can I use any type of coolant in the Triton’s overflow bottle?

A: No, it’s important to use the recommended coolant type specified in your vehicle’s owner’s manual. Using the wrong type of coolant can lead to cooling system damage and reduced performance.

Q: What should I do if the overflow bottle is leaking?

A: If you notice any leaks, it’s important to have them repaired as soon as possible. Leaks can lead to coolant loss, overheating, and potential engine damage. Contact a qualified technician to diagnose and fix the issue.

Q: Can I replace the overflow bottle myself?

A: While it is possible to replace the overflow bottle yourself, it is recommended to have it done by a qualified technician to ensure proper installation and avoid any potential issues.
